Description: This Interactive Colloquium provides a venue for a scholarly discussion of issues, perspectives, and best practices in service-learning. We will explore the roots of service-learning by looking at dimensions of civic engagement, which include values, knowledge, skills, efficacy, commitment, and empathy. We will discuss and ask you to reflect on the role and value of each dimension as well as connect you with resources for developing innovative and creative civic engagement strategies and programs. The goals for this session are four-fold: (1) To understand service-learning’s roots in civic engagement theory, (2) To gain an understanding of dimensions of civic engagement, (3) To understand some issues with and best practices of service-learning, and (4) To develop strategies and activities for introducing civic engagement in your classrooms. |
